Utah State University is located in Logan, UT.

In the most recent year for which we have data, 17 home economics education degrees were granted at Utah State University.

Online & Distance Learning at Utah State University

Many students take online classes at Utah State University. Of 28,904 students, 5,333 (18%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 11,938 (41%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the student demographics for Home Economics Education graduates at Utah State University, broken down by degree level.

Looking at the program as a whole, Home Economics Education graduates at Utah State University are 100% women (17) and 0% men (0).

Home Economics Education Bachelor’s Program at Utah State University

Among the 17 bachelor’s home economics education degrees awarded at Utah State University, 100% were women (17) and 0% were men (0).

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Home Economics Education bachelor’s degree recipients at Utah State University.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 15
Asian 1
American Indian / Alaska Native 1
Racial-ethnic diversity of Home Economics Education majors at Utah State University

Minority students account for 12% of Home Economics Education bachelor’s degree recipients at Utah State University, lower than the national average of 17%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
